Do we think Gods messengers are blind?

By Toni Ullom



Revival this weekend! Oh my, guess I best do a little praying and maybe throw in a little bible study. Wouldn't want God to let the minister know "I've been slacking off!" Guess what, as they say "to little to late". A prayed up, fasted up, man of God doesn't need to look at your everyday life to see what is or is not being done in your life. The only one we fool is ourselves. I myself don't even try to make excuses in this area, I just fess up cause if I said I did and didn't, I'd just have to repent for lying.

Have you ever gotten that feeling when you stand near a preacher of being looked right through? Sheeze I have so many times and been so intimidated. Thank God he doesn't tell on us like we perceive in our imagination, actually we do that all by ourselves. By our attitudes, our trying to hide out and avoid those we know are close enough to God that it makes us squirm to be in the same room with them. I like the back bench myself, not because of hiding out, that's just my spot but at one time it was where I choose because I was uncomfortable with a man or woman of God getting to close to me.

I have been fortunate enough to have teachers who give me time to let God scold me, on occasion when I don't listen to him, he has to send someone to nudge me however. Sometimes I would just as soon they come out and just push me a bit in the right direction directly. I know, I just gave them permission to do that, well that is if they read this... however sometimes its a good thing to get that stubborn nature pointed in the right direction. Doesn't that hurt my feelings? Sometimes, but once I get past the oh poor pitiful me and face the truth, I am glad for the correction.


A prayed up, fasted up, teacher isn't anything to be feared, at least he or she shouldn't be. Because anything that they have to instruct you on, isn't from them, it's from God and you know he isn't going to hurt you, he loved you enough to give his last breath for you.
